Shop Atmosphere

Shop is split into two connected rooms: a warm, moss-draped elven workshop up front smelling of pine and oil, and a cluttered, echoing 'Goblin Annex' in back where curious tinkery and odd parts are sold. Sildra hums old elven tunes while she works and often trades repair work for stories or a goblin-engineering curiosity. She'll haggle with those who can impress her with a clever tool use or a riddle; she distrusts loud, clumsy displays of force and charges more to fix weapons damaged by pure brute strength.
